Hawks Trade John Collins to Jazz in Cap-Clearing Deal
- The Hawks traded John Collins to the Utah Jazz for Rudy Gay and a future second-round pick.
- The trade allows the Hawks to get under the luxury tax threshold and clear cap space for future moves.
- Collins, the Hawks' 2017 first-round pick, averaged 13.1 points and 6.5 rebounds per game last season.
- Gay, 36, is owed $6.5 million next season, allowing the Hawks to save money and gain flexibility.
- The Jazz add an athletic big man to pair with Lauri Markkanen and rookie Walker Kessler.
